The application segment of the Asia Pacific PAE market primarily focuses on the treatment of ben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H). PAE offers a minimally invasive alternative to traditional surgical interventions, making it an increasingly preferred choice among clinicians and patients. The market segmentation by application helps identify specific areas where PAE is making the most impact and guides strategic decisions for stakeholders.
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ia (BPH): The primary application of PAE, targeting prostate enlargement to alleviate urinary symptoms and improve quality of life.
Prostate Cancer Management: An emerging application where PAE is used adjunctively to reduce prostate size or manage complications in prostate cancer patients.
Other Urological Conditions: Includes treatment of conditions like prostatitis or other prostate-related disorders where embolization may provide symptom relief.

Q1: What is prostatic arterial embolization (PAE)?
PAE is a minimally invasive procedure that blocks blood flow to the prostate, reducing its size and alleviating symptoms of BPH.
Q2: How effective is PAE in treating BPH?
Studies show PAE significantly improves urinary symptoms and quality of life, with success rates comparable to surgical options.
Q3: Is PAE safe for elderly patients?
Yes, PAE is considered safe for elderly patients, offering a lower risk profile compared to traditional surgery.
Q4: What are the common complications associated with PAE?
Potential complications include transient pain, hematuria, or urinary retention, but serious adverse events are rare.
Q5: How does PAE compare to TURP (transurethral resection of the prostate)?
PAE offers a less invasive alternative with fewer complications and shorter recovery times, though long-term data is still emerging.
Q6: What is the typical patient profile for PAE?
Patients with moderate to severe BPH who are unsuitable for surgery or prefer minimally invasive options are ideal candidates.
Q7: Are there any contraindications for PAE?
Contraindications include active infection, severe atherosclerosis, or allergies to embolic agents used during the procedure.
